Section 9–603. Agreement on Standards Concerning Rights and Duties.
(a) Agreed standards. The parties may determine by agreement the standards measuring the fulfillment of the rights of a debtor or obligor and the duties of a secured party under a rule stated in Section 9–602 if the standards are not manifestly unreasonable.
(b) Agreed standards inapplicable to breach of peace. Subsection (a) does not apply to the duty under Section 9–609 to refrain from breaching the peace.
